import argparse
import logging
import os.path
from typing import Dict, List, cast
import requests
from twine import commands
from twine import exceptions
from twine import package as package_file
from twine import settings
from twine import utils
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
def skip_upload(
response: requests.Response, skip_existing: bool, package: package_file.PackageFile
) -> bool:
if not skip_existing:
return False
status = response.status_code
reason = getattr(response, "reason", "").lower()
text = getattr(response, "text", "").lower()
# NOTE(sigmavirus24): PyPI presently returns a 400 status code with the
# error message in the reason attribute. Other implementations return a
# 403 or 409 status code.
return (
# pypiserver (https://pypi.org/project/pypiserver)
status == 409
# PyPI / TestPyPI
or (status == 400 and "already exist" in reason)
# Nexus Repository OSS (https://www.sonatype.com/nexus-repository-oss)
or (status == 400 and any("updating asset" in x for x in [reason, text]))
# Artifactory (https://jfrog.com/artifactory/)
or (status == 403 and "overwrite artifact" in text)
# Gitlab Enterprise Edition (https://about.gitlab.com)
or (status == 400 and "already been taken" in text)
)
def _make_package(
filename: str, signatures: Dict[str, str], upload_settings: settings.Settings
) -> package_file.PackageFile:
"""Create and sign a package, based off of filename, signatures and settings."""
package = package_file.PackageFile.from_filename(filename, upload_settings.comment)
signed_name = package.signed_basefilename
if signed_name in signatures:
package.add_gpg_signature(signatures[signed_name], signed_name)
elif upload_settings.sign:
package.sign(upload_settings.sign_with, upload_settings.identity)
file_size = utils.get_file_size(package.filename)
logger.info(f" {package.filename} ({file_size})")
if package.gpg_signature:
logger.info(f" Signed with {package.signed_filename}")
return package
def upload(upload_settings: settings.Settings, dists: List[str]) -> None:
dists = commands._find_dists(dists)
# Determine if the user has passed in pre-signed distributions
signatures = {os.path.basename(d): d for d in dists if d.endswith(".asc")}
uploads = [i for i in dists if not i.endswith(".asc")]
upload_settings.check_repository_url()
repository_url = cast(str, upload_settings.repository_config["repository"])
print(f"Uploading distributions to {repository_url}")
packages_to_upload = [
_make_package(filename, signatures, upload_settings) for filename in uploads
]
repository = upload_settings.create_repository()
uploaded_packages = []
for package in packages_to_upload:
skip_message = " Skipping {} because it appears to already exist".format(
package.basefilename
)
# Note: The skip_existing check *needs* to be first, because otherwise
# we're going to generate extra HTTP requests against a hardcoded
# URL for no reason.
if upload_settings.skip_existing and repository.package_is_uploaded(package):
print(skip_message)
continue
resp = repository.upload(package)
# Bug 92. If we get a redirect we should abort because something seems
# funky. The behaviour is not well defined and redirects being issued
# by PyPI should never happen in reality. This should catch malicious
# redirects as well.
if resp.is_redirect:
raise exceptions.RedirectDetected.from_args(
repository_url,
resp.headers["location"],
)
if skip_upload(resp, upload_settings.skip_existing, package):
print(skip_message)
continue
utils.check_status_code(resp, upload_settings.verbose)
uploaded_packages.append(package)
release_urls = repository.release_urls(uploaded_packages)
if release_urls:
print("\nView at:")
for url in release_urls:
print(url)
# Bug 28. Try to silence a ResourceWarning by clearing the connection
# pool.
repository.close()
def main(args: List[str]) -> None:
parser = argparse.ArgumentParser(prog="twine upload")
settings.Settings.register_argparse_arguments(parser)
parser.add_argument(
"dists",
nargs="+",
metavar="dist",
help="The distribution files to upload to the repository "
"(package index). Usually dist/* . May additionally contain "
"a .asc file to include an existing signature with the "
"file upload.",
)
parsed_args = parser.parse_args(args)
upload_settings = settings.Settings.from_argparse(parsed_args)
# Call the upload function with the arguments from the command line
return upload(upload_settings, parsed_args.dists)
